## CSV Import Wizard — Plugin Hooks

The Quillbarrow import wizard exposes three hooks: pre-parse, row-transform, and commit. Register them in your plugin manifest. Rows failing validation are quarantined, not dropped; your transform must be idempotent. Test against the Harlow sandbox dataset before requesting review. Max payload per row is 64 KB. Packaged plugins are rejected unless signed. Sign your bundle with the key below.

deploy key for kajof-yawif: bky9_fvxrpdHPq

# Customer Concentration — Heads Up

Managers only, please. Roughly 46% of Fenbright Tooling's revenue now comes from one client, Ardlow Marine. Great account, risky dependency. Procurement and sales are mapping alternatives, and contract renewal talks start soon. Keep this off team channels for now. The mitigation plan we're actually pursuing sits right below.

management briefing: The renewal with Quenaelox Group closes at $2 million a year, 15 percent below the last contract. Project Holwyn slips by six weeks because of the tooling delay.

Insurance Renewal — Managers Only

Our group policy with Hartwell Mutual renews at fiscal year-end. Premiums rise 9% following last year's Drayford depot claim. Coverage for the Lensmoor fleet is unchanged; cyber cover is expanded. Heads of department must confirm asset registers by month-end. No action needed from staff below manager level. Implications for next year's planning appear in the confidential note below.

management briefing: Silethax Systems plans to raise the Holix list price by 50.2 percent in December. The steering committee signed off on a budget of $329.9 million for Project Holok. The renewal with Juldorax Foods closes at $278.2 million a year, 54.3 percent above the last contract. Project Briir slips by one quarter because of the supplier delay.

## Changelog — Ticktrace 1.9

### Renamed: DRIFT_API_TOKEN
During the cron drift investigation we found plugins confusing this variable with the metrics token, so it has been renamed to indicate it authorizes drift-report uploads specifically. Plugin authors must read the new name from 1.9 onward; the old name is ignored without warning. Sample env files in the SDK are updated. In your deployment env file, the drift-report upload secret is set on the next line.

env line for fawef-taguf: VAULT_KEY13=a9695905a9a90